Item 6.    Indemnification of Directors and Officers.

                The Delaware General Corporation Law permits Delaware corporations to eliminate or limit the monetary liability of directors for breach of their fiduciary duty of care, subject to limitations. The Company’s amended and restated certificate of incorporation provides that the Company’s directors are not liable to the Company or its shareholders for monetary damages for breach of fiduciary duty as a director, except for liability (i) for any breach of the director’s duty of loyalty to the Company or its shareholders, (ii) for acts or omissions not in good faith or which involve intentional misconduct or a knowing violation of law, (iii) for willful or negligent violation of the laws governing the payment of dividends or the purchase or redemption of stock or (iv) for any transaction from which a director derived an improper personal benefit.

                The Delaware General Corporation Law provides for indemnification of directors, officers, employees and agents subject to limitations. The Company’s amended bylaws and the appendix thereto provide for the indemnification of directors, officers, employees and agents to the extent permitted by Delaware law. The Company’s directors and officers also are insured against certain liabilities for actions taken in such capacities, including liabilities under the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the “Securities Act”). The Company has entered into indemnity agreements with its directors and certain of its officers whereby the Company has agreed to indemnify the directors and officers to the extent permitted by Delaware law.

B.       Insofar as indemnification for liabilities arising under the Securities Act may be permitted to directors, officers and controlling persons of the Company pursuant to the foregoing provisions, or otherwise, the Company has been advised that in the opinion of the Commission such indemnification is against public policy as expressed in the Securities Act and is, therefore, unenforceable. In the event that a claim for indemnification against such liabilities (other than the payment by the Company of expenses incurred or paid by a director, officer or controlling person of the Company in the successful defense of any action, suit or proceeding) is asserted by such director, officer or controlling person in connection with the securities being registered, the Company will, unless in the opinion of its counsel the matter has been settled by controlling precedent, submit to a court of appropriate jurisdiction the question whether such indemnification by it is against public policy as expressed in the Securities Act and will be governed by the final adjudication of such issue.
